Relative Strength Index (RSI)
The Relative Strength Index (RSI) measures the speed and change of price movements to determine whether an asset is overbought or oversold. On the weekly timeframe, FOXY currently shows an RSI reading of 0.00, signaling extreme bearish momentum. This historically low level suggests that selling pressure has been intense and sustained.
An RSI below 30 typically indicates oversold conditions, but FOXY’s reading near zero implies a deeper imbalance between buyers and sellers. A reversal above 50 would be required to confirm a shift toward bullish sentiment. Until then, the 50 level acts as strong resistance on the RSI chart.
Moving Averages (MA)
Moving averages help smooth out price data to identify trends over time. The relationship between short-term and long-term moving averages—particularly the 50-day MA and 200-day MA—is widely used to assess trend strength.
On the weekly chart, Foxy is currently in a neutral trend phase. Neither a golden cross (50-day MA above 200-day MA) nor a death cross (the reverse) has formed. Additionally, price action is occurring below both moving averages, suggesting that even if a crossover occurs, bullish confirmation requires sustained trading above these levels.
For intermediate trends (daily timeframe), there are no clear signals yet. The lack of alignment between price and moving averages indicates indecision in the market, which often precedes significant breakouts—either upward or downward.
MACD (Moving Average Convergence Divergence)
The MACD indicator combines exponential moving averages to highlight changes in momentum. Currently, Foxy’s MACD line remains below the signal line, with a negative histogram that has persisted for over 50 periods on the weekly chart.
This extended bearish MACD phase reflects continuous downward momentum and weak buying interest. A reversal pattern—where the MACD line crosses above the signal line while the histogram turns positive—would be needed to suggest accumulating strength.
Until such a signal emerges, traders should remain cautious about expecting strong upward movements.

Supply and Demand Dynamics
With a fixed circulating supply of 4 billion FOXY, scarcity plays a limited role unless demand increases significantly. Unlike deflationary tokens with buybacks or burns, FOXY lacks mechanisms to reduce supply, making adoption and utility critical for price appreciation.
Whale Activity
Large holders—commonly referred to as "whales"—can heavily influence low-cap cryptocurrencies like FOXY. Sudden sell-offs by major addresses can trigger sharp drops, while coordinated buying may spark rallies. Monitoring on-chain data for wallet movements can offer early warnings of potential volatility.
